Soil Dampness Sensors
Dirt dampness sensing units play a crucial duty in modern-day watering systems, offering real-time data that boosts water efficiency. These devices determine the volumetric water material in the soil, permitting accurate analyses of dampness levels. By integrating soil dampness sensing units into irrigation systems, individuals can avoid overwatering or underwatering, eventually advertising healthier plant development and saving water resources.The sensing units transfer information to controllers, which can change sprinkling routines based on present dirt conditions. This data-driven method reduces water waste and assurances that plants get the finest amount of dampness.
